Quality Control Manager manages the inspection and testing of materials, parts, and products to ensure adherence to established quality standards. Proposes corrective actions to improve compliance with quality specifications. Being a Quality Control Manager recommends new or improved quality control methods, procedures, and/or standards.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Quality Control Manager typ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The Quality Control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Quality Control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    JOB SUMMARY:  The Construction Quality Control Manager (QCM) has overall responsibility for reporting directly to the Project Manager and Corporate Management for the verification that we meet all quality standards on our projects.  The Quality Control Manager (project level) plans, coordinates, and oversees implementation of Construction quality control and quality assurance programs at the project level.  This position also creates reviews and amends Project Quality Plans to keep them current and to ensure compliance in all respects with the contract, established standards, methods, and specifications.

    Responsibilities

    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

    • Create and manage the Quality Control Plan for success on assigned construction projects
    • Read and understand complex contract specifications, documents, and architectural/engineering/mechanical and electrical drawings
    • Interpret an extensive variety of technical instructions in mathematical or diagram form and deal with several abstract and concrete variables
    • Define problems, collect data, establish facts, and draw valid conclusions
    • Review and approve submittals, process, and understand RFI’s
    • Create a Daily Activity Report to be a detailed, thorough, and complete historical record of the day’s daily activities.
    • Work with others in a team environment to ensure contract requirements, project goals and objectives are met
    • Communicate and reason with client’s quality assurance personnel and technical experts, and field quality assurance, technical authorities, and construction supervisory representatives
    • Make presentations, host meetings, and engage in problem solving by bringing together technical experts, authorities having jurisdiction, assigning action items, documenting minutes and follow through to closure
    • Proficiency in QCS/RMS software applications, Word, Excel, and Outlook
    • Prepare graphs, charts of data, proposals, reports, and manuals
    • Implement the three phases of quality control
    • Read survey shots (grade and elevation)
    • Mentor Quality Control Specialists
    • Other duties as assigned

     

    S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Depending on size, complexity and number of Definable Features of Work, this position manages the Project Quality Control Plan, ensures all contract requirements are being met and supervises project Quality Control Inspectors.

Oregon (/ˈɒrɪɡən/ (listen) ORR-ih-gən) is a state in the Pacific Northwest region on the West Coast of the United States. The Columbia River delineates much of Oregon's northern boundary with Washington, while the Snake River delineates much of its eastern boundary with Idaho. The parallel 42° north delineates the southern boundary with California and Nevada. Oregon is one of only four states of the continental United States to have a coastline on the Pacific Ocean.
